Windows 10 - Change the Browser Start / Home Page

Here's how to change the Edge browser start / home page on your Windows 10 device.
  1. From the Home screen, tap or click the
    Microsoft Edge icon
    Microsoft Edge icon (located in the system tray at the bottom of the screen to the right of the search box).
    If not available, navigate:
    All apps icon All apps icon
    Microsoft Edge
    .
  2. Tap or click the
    Options icon
    (located in the upper-right) then select
    Settings
    .
    Select Options Then Settings
  3. Tap the
    Dropdown arrow
    under the "Open Microsoft Edge with" section then select
    A specific page or pages
    .
  4. Enter a web address in the provided box then tap or click the
    Save icon
    Save icon to the right of the web address.
    This adds an additional web page to the default page that opens when Microsoft Edge is first opened.
    Additional pages can be added by entering the page address then tapping or clicking
    + Add new page
    (located below the web address).
    To stop specific pages from appearing when launching Microsoft Edge, press the
    X symbol
    to the right of the web page and that page will no longer launch.
